Output ebc71aee68348c4a87bc3f99fca0a6bbf2fdac8a1c846a6c4dccfa7c647f815f:0

value
2601186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19abf27671251af6692d3ede954416347bddc8e2 OP_EQUAL
address
342koSB4p1SrGh462rqVgdYqYqLxmNp8NZ
transaction
ebc71aee68348c4a87bc3f99fca0a6bbf2fdac8a1c846a6c4dccfa7c647f815f
confirmations
69383
spent
true